Rule 560-10-28-.02 - Registration

Any private person, firm, partnership, or corporation qualifying and acting as a tag service company under the definition as set forth in this chapter shall, before engaging in such service, comply with the following registration requirements on an annual calendar basis:

(a) Each tag service company shall register with the Georgia State Revenue Commissioner at least 30 days before commencing business, through the office of the local county tag agent in the county where the main business office of the tag service company shall be located. The registration form shall be signed and sworn to by the owner(s) of said company, or if said company is a corporation, by the president and secretary, and shall contain the following information:
1. The complete names and home addresses of all individuals with ownership interests in said tag service company and the length of time such individuals have resided at such address.
2. The complete names, addresses and telephone numbers under which such service shall operate including all branch offices of said service.
3. A list of the counties in this State in which said service will do business.
4. A statement that all city and county business license ordinances have been complied with and the date such business licenses were obtained.
5. The complete names of all employees and associates of said service and a description of any experience that such employees and associates have had in completing motor vehicle license tag application forms and computing motor vehicle ad valorem taxes.
6. The complete names of each owner, employee and associate of said service who has been engaged in the same or similar service in the three years prior to the date of registration and the names and addresses of any such service companies with which such individuals were previously associated.
